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8662 5344934948 63253736262 7827713031 2907693
16 5473094766 302468
16 5473094766 302468
87727278 90350074 11568610359 179
All about undefined
Interested in learning more?
16 5473094766 302468
87727278 90350074 11568610359 179
See more
26264411294 68 4598103
05 9635455566 97487615
See more
45 1018569994 658535
578075433 95 067
See more